Output 39dcb7ff1341d7c3e25ea4f6353f2cb70d516947fcd4cd8768f67503a386c459:2

value
1960364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c58c05e58761fef03c0106812fefe5fb53fcaa OP_EQUAL
address
3MTCXnMs29pE83NxoETavCDxSJFTxCPMJV
transaction
39dcb7ff1341d7c3e25ea4f6353f2cb70d516947fcd4cd8768f67503a386c459
spent
true